Patrick lives with a number of critical conditions affecting his brain and spine, and undergoes regular treatment at University Hospital Limerick. He suffered a stroke in 2021, and is currently receiving end of life treatment at The Children’s Ark. It was here where his nurse, Patsie, referred him to receive his wish.
Patrick responds well to sensory lights and he has a passion for music. After meeting with Patrick and his mum, Veronika, it was clear getting a blessing in Knock would be their ultimate wish for Patrick
Due to his complex needs, he needed to be transported by ambulance on his wish day. We got in touch with our friends at Bumbulance, who helped us helped to transport Patrick and his family to and from Knock.
When the day arrived, Patrick and his mum travelled to Knock, and they were met on arrival by volunteer Louise, who gave them a tour of the site. They were then met by Father Gibbons, who blessed Patrick, with the Choir singing loudly in the background.
Afterwards, Patrick got to experience his very own room, ‘Patricks’s Room’, complete with music and sensory lighting, allowing him to feel calm and relaxed. They even played music from ‘The Sound Of Music’ , Patrick’s favourite musical!
His mum told us afterwards: Thanks a million for every detail that you prepared. I woke up the next morning not knowing if the day was just a dream. The sound of music playing for Patrick, the choir who sang for him, and his blessing, it truly was the best day of our lives.
